#!/usr/bin/env python3
#
# Determines which clang-tidy checks are "fast enough" to run in clangd.
# This runs clangd --check --check-tidy-time and parses the output.
# This program outputs a header fragment specifying which checks are fast:
# FAST(bugprone-argument-comment, 5)
# SLOW(misc-const-correctness, 200)
# If given the old header fragment as input, we lean to preserve its choices.
#
# This is not deterministic or hermetic, but should be run occasionally to
# update the list of allowed checks. From llvm-project:
# clang-tools-extra/clangd/TidyFastChecks.py --clangd=build-opt/bin/clangd
# Be sure to use an optimized, no-asserts, tidy-enabled build of clangd!
import argparse
import os
import re
import subprocess
import sys
# Checks faster than FAST_THRESHOLD are fast, slower than SLOW_THRESHOLD slow.
# If a check is in between, we stick with our previous decision. This avoids
# enabling/disabling checks between releases due to random measurement jitter.
FAST_THRESHOLD = 8 # percent
SLOW_THRESHOLD = 15
parser = argparse.ArgumentParser()
parser.add_argument(
"--target",
help="X-macro output file. "
"If it exists, existing contents will be used for hysteresis",
default="clang-tools-extra/clangd/TidyFastChecks.inc",
)
parser.add_argument(
"--source",
help="Source file to benchmark tidy checks",
default="clang/lib/Sema/Sema.cpp",
)
parser.add_argument(
"--clangd", help="clangd binary to invoke", default="build/bin/clangd"
)
parser.add_argument("--checks", help="check glob to run", default="*")
parser.add_argument("--verbose", help="log clangd output", action="store_true")
args = parser.parse_args()
# Use the preprocessor to extract the list of previously-fast checks.
def read_old_fast(path):
text = subprocess.check_output(
[
"cpp",
"-P", # Omit GNU line markers
"-nostdinc", # Don't include stdc-predef.h
"-DFAST(C,T)=C", # Print fast checks only
path,
]
)
for line in text.splitlines():
if line.strip():
yield line.strip().decode("utf-8")
old_fast = list(read_old_fast(args.target)) if os.path.exists(args.target) else []
print(f"Old fast checks: {old_fast}", file=sys.stderr)
# Runs clangd --check --check-tidy-time.
# Yields (check, percent-overhead) pairs.
def measure():
process = subprocess.Popen(
[
args.clangd,
"--check=" + args.source,
"--check-locations=0", # Skip useless slow steps.
"--check-tidy-time=" + args.checks,
],
stderr=subprocess.PIPE,
)
recording = False
for line in iter(process.stderr.readline, b""):
if args.verbose:
print("clangd> ", line, file=sys.stderr)
if not recording:
if b"Timing AST build with individual clang-tidy checks" in line:
recording = True
continue
if b"Finished individual clang-tidy checks" in line:
return
match = re.search(rb"(\S+) = (\S+)%", line)
if match:
yield (match.group(1).decode("utf-8"), float(match.group(2)))
with open(args.target, "w", buffering=1) as target:
# Produce an includable X-macros fragment with our decisions.
print(
f"""// This file is generated, do not edit it directly!
// Deltas are percentage regression in parsing {args.source}
#ifndef FAST
#define FAST(CHECK, DELTA)
#endif
#ifndef SLOW
#define SLOW(CHECK, DELTA)
#endif
""",
file=target,
)
for check, time in measure():
threshold = SLOW_THRESHOLD if check in old_fast else FAST_THRESHOLD
decision = "FAST" if time <= threshold else "SLOW"
print(f"{decision} {check} {time}% <= {threshold}%", file=sys.stderr)
print(f"{decision}({check}, {time})", file=target)
print(
"""
#undef FAST
#undef SLOW
""",
file=target,
)
